10:00 AM

Meeting Point

We meet at Republic square, in front of the Apple store.

10:00 AM

Republic Square

The tour begins where the history of Florence began, in what is today known as Republic square.

10:40 AM

Piazza San Giovanni

A view of the Cathedral of Florence, Santa Maria del Fiore, with its magnificent dome, a masterpiece by Filipo Brunelleschi, the Giotto Bell Tower and the Baptistery dedicated to Saint John the Baptist.

11:10 AM

Piazza San Martino

In this square are some truly unique features of Florence, like the Chestnut Tower, the oratory of San Martino, and about Dante Alighieri, Italy's greatest poet, who lived in this very part of town.

11:40 AM

Piazza della Signoria

In this most famous square we learn all about the saga of the Medici dynasty, their influence on the history, politics and even the arts in Renaissance Florence.

12:10 PM

Ponte Vecchio

Time for a quick break with a view on the famous Old Bridge.

12:30 PM

Piazza Santa Trinita

This square offers important examples of different architectural styles.

12:50 PM

Piazza Santa Maria Novella

the tour ends in the square of the seven centuries old Dominican Friars church.

Ending Point

Santa Maria Novella Square

Tour Important Information

- This tour is customizable, please write to me if you have specific requests. Unless it's a deluge, my tours run whatever the weather.

- Dress code is casual. However, please bear in mind that certain venues (churches, religious sites) require that your shoulders and knees be covered. Also, it is good manners to take your hat of cap off when entering a church (except in wintertime, when you can keep it on to stay warm).

- It is preferable to have a little cash with you (that's Euros) as some places may only accept payment in cash.

- Please think of your hydration. If you have a bottle of water with you, we can get refills along the way.
